2015-10-27 1 views
0

После устранения ошибки, из-за которой мои файлы журналов взорвались (файлы журналов объемом 2+ ГБ, заполненные одним и тем же журналом исключений), я удалил затронутые файлы журналов, чтобы избежать лишнего пространство. Это была ошибка, которая составляла пару дней, и она затрагивала несколько файлов журналов.Larvel 4.2 файлы журнала не создаются

Поскольку удаление файлов журнала, однако, похоже, что laravel прекратил записывать что-либо. Ежедневный журнал за день, когда я сделал удаление, похоже, остановил запись в тот момент, когда я удалил старые ежедневные файлы, и с тех пор никаких новых ежедневных файлов не было создано.

Я обновил компоновщик, кустарник-автозагрузка, кустарный сборщик и кустарь ремесленника: ясный, безрезультатно. Настройки разрешения все выглядят прекрасно, насколько я могу судить, и назначаются правильному пользователю. Изменений конфигурации вообще не было, буквально единственная разница заключалась в удалении старых ежедневных файлов журнала.

Может ли кто-нибудь указать мне в правильном направлении? При необходимости я могу предоставить больше информации, если мне не хватает чего-либо соответствующего.

+0

Очевидным подозреваемым является разрешение файла. Вы смотрите на свой журнал ошибок php? Может ли laravel записывать в ваш журнал? Просто попробуйте 'file_put_contents ('/ path/to/log/dir/debug', 'test');' от контроллера и посмотреть, работает ли он – Alfwed

+0

Это действительно сработало, поэтому я попытался добавить Log :: debug ('test ') вызвать команду artisan и успешно создать файл журнала. Это очень необычно, в нашем ведении журнала должно быть разбито место, в файле обычно есть постоянный поток зарегистрированных действий. – sitrick2

+0

Обратите внимание, что apache или любой другой веб-сервер, возможно, не имеет того же разрешения, что и ваш пользователь, выполняющий команду artisan. – Alfwed

ответ

1

Оказывается, это вовсе не ошибка регистрации; выясняется, что мой планировщик cron отключился, а ключевые процессы не выполнялись. Разную проблему решить, но рад узнать, что я не нарушил регистрацию.

 Смежные вопросы

  • Нет связанных вопросов^_^